Water Horse Hydroelectric Harvester Dual Oscillator Field Testing Data, UAF - Nenana Alaska, 2021
Raw and processed timeseries data generated during field testing of a single "galloping oscillator" Water Horse prototype at PMEC (Pacific Marine Energy Center) Tanana River Test Site in Nenana, AK for 3 weeks in 2021. Data collection by University of Alaska, Fairbanks.
